Israel - Export of Sawing Machines for Working Hard Materials
Since 2014, Israel Export of Sawing Machines for Working Hard Materials was up 68.3% year on year. In 2019, the country was number 40 among other countries in Export of Sawing Machines for Working Hard Materials with $1,662,928.33. Israel is overtaken by South Africa, which was ranked number 39 with $1,680,207.21 and is followed by Thailand at $1,607,986.23. China topped the ranking with $718,510,391.74 in 2019, that is +3% compared to 2018. Germany, Italy and Austria resp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Bolivia recorded the best 5 years average growth at +266.9% per year, while Senegal was the worst growing country at -69.3% per year.
